Sea tragedy as gales rage

FOUR crewmen drowned, one is still missing and one was rescued after a fishing trawler capsized off Mossel Bay yesterday as gale-force winds lashed the Southern and Eastern Cape coastline.

Hikers being evacuated from Otter Trail

Hikers were being evacuated from the Otter Trail on Wednesday as bitterly cold and stormy weather swept the Southern Cape coast, the Garden Route National Park said.

Rains batter WCape, rescuers on the hop

HEAVY rain continued to lash the Southern and Western Cape yesterday with almost 200 people evacuated from their homes in Eden district and the neighbouring regions of Cape Winelands and Overberg even harder hit.

Storm Blues for Cape Matrics

Hundreds of people have taken shelter in community halls and groups of matriculants have scrambled to get to their exams as the black south-easter closed roads and wreaked havoc through the Western Cape.
